As a rule of thumb, you’ll need to grill your roast for 15 to 20 minutes per pound, depending on your desired doneness. A medium rare roast should cook to 130 to 135 degrees, while a medium roast should cook to about 140 degrees before removing it from the grill.To roast on the grill, meat needs to be placed over indirect heat or a “flame-free” area. To create an indirect-cooking area, turn off one burner on a gas grill. On a charcoal grill, push coals to one side of the grill. Roast the meat on the flame-free section of the grill.

What roast is best for BBQ?

The best cuts to use for grill-roasting are those that you’d ordinarily roast at high heat in the oven—cuts from the loin, tenderloin, sirloin, leg, and round. I generally stick with a small to medium roast ( 2 to 6 pounds) since I can usually cook it without refueling the fire.

What temperature do you cook a beef roast on a rotisserie?

Get Ready
Rotisserie Roasting Doneness (for both Rotisserie and Indirect Heat)
minutes/lb minutes/kg Internal temperature when removed from heat
20-22 42-47 Med rare (145ºF/63°C)
22-25 50-55 Medium (155° F/68°C)
30 65 Well (165°F/74°C)

How do you BBQ a roast beef?

Lightly spray beef with oil, season, and top with sage crust. Place beef in the centre of barbecue and turn burners directly under it off. Leave the remaining burners on to conduct and circulate heat around beef. Close lid and cook beef for 80 minutes for rare, 100 minutes for medium and 120 minutes for well done.

How do you cook a bottom round roast on a gas grill?

Turn down heat to 350°F Let sear 5 minutes. Then turn roast & sear other sides – 5 minutes apiece. Keep lid down when not turning. Decrease fire to 325°F & cook approximately 12 minutes a pound, periodically lifting lid to turn & test with meat thermometer until desired doneness reached.

How do you bake on a BBQ?

Just preheat your gas grill as usual for 10 to 15 minutes, and then moderate the temperature by setting the control knobs at medium-off-medium, which will give you a 300° to 350° F oven temperature. If the recipe calls for a hotter oven, turn up the control knobs but leave the center knob off for indirect cooking.
